On-chip generation and reaction of unstable intermediates-monolithic nanoreactors for diazonium chemistry: azo dyes.

Robert C Wootton1, Robin Fortt, Andrew J de Mello.   

Abstract

Monolithic nanoreactors for the safe and expedient continuous synthesis of products requiring unstable intermediates were fabricated and tested by the synthesis of azo dyes under hydrodynamic pumping regimes.
